BLOGas.lt
Sukurk savo BLOGą Kitas atsitiktinis BLOGas

.NET Framework 4.0 plakatas

Parašė Sergejus | 2008-10-31 18:25

Kaip ir su ankstesniomis .NET Framework versijomis, tik pradėjus šnekėti apie 4 versiją pasirodė ir .NET Framework 4.0 plakatas. Prieinamos PDF ir Silverlight DeepZoom versijos.


Rodyk draugams

PDC sesijų transliacijos

Parašė Sergejus | 2008-10-30 00:04

Pasirodė pirmų PDC konferencijos dienų transliacijos. Kiekvienas tikrai ras sau įdomių temų…

Rodyk draugams

Silverlight Toolkit ir WPF Toolkit

Parašė Sergejus | 2008-10-29 00:04

Matomai visos Microsoft komandos ruošėsi PDC. Dar viena konferencijos naujiena - Silverlight Toolkit. Esmė labai panaši į ASP.NET AJAX Toolkit, tai yra atskirame projekte pateikiami papildomi komponentai bei temos skirti Silverlight 2.0.



Šiuo metu projektas apima tokius komponentus:



  • AutoCompleteBox

  • NumericUpDown

  • Viewbox

  • Expander

  • ImplicitStyleManager

  • Charting

  • TreeView

  • DockPanel

  • WrapPanel

  • Label

  • HeaderedContentControl

  • HeaderedItemsControl

Taip pat kartu pateikiamos kelios Silverlight vizualios schemos, tad galėsite greitai pakeisti jūsų aplikacijos išvaizdą.


Tuo pat metu buvo anonsuotas ir kitas projektas - WPF Toolkit, tiesa jis kol kas apima žymiai mažiau komponentų:



  • WPF DataGrid

  • DatePicker/Calendar

  • VisualStateManager

Rodyk draugams

Enterprise Library 4.1 ir Unity 1.2

Parašė Sergejus | 2008-10-29 00:03

Jau porą metų savo projektuose aš naudoju Enterprise Library, o paskutiniame ir pakankamai naują Microsoft priklausomybių injekcijos karkasą Unity. Džiugu, kad šiandien buvo išleistos Enterprise Library 4.1 ir Unity 1.2. Pagrinde tai klaidų pataisymai, bet yra ir tam tikrų pasikeitimų (ypač Unity), apie kuriuose galite pasiskaityti čia.

Rodyk draugams

Oficialus jQuery intellisense failas

Parašė Sergejus | 2008-10-28 21:07

Aš jau rašiau, kad nuo šiol Microsoft oficialiai palaiko jQuery JavaScript biblioteką, o dabar jau ir oficialiai išleistas jQuery intellisense failas.


P.S.


Asmeniškai aš susidūriau su problema, kad jQuery atsisako tvarkingai veikti kai naudojamas Master Page ir nuoroda į jQuery intellisense failą įtraukiama po nuorodos į patį jQuery. Po tam tikro derinimo radau išeitį - reikia pirmą įtraukti nuorodą į intellisense failą, o tik paskui į jQuery. Tikiuosi sutaupysite laiko ;)

Rodyk draugams

Visual Studio 2010, Azure platforma ir kitos naujienos iš PDC

Parašė Sergejus | 2008-10-27 19:24

Ką tik pasibaigė PDC įžanginė sesija, kurios metu buvo pristatytas .NET Framework 4.0, Visual Studio 2010, nauja Microsoft platforma Azure ir kiti įdomus dalykai. 


Pirmą Visual Studio 2010 CTP versiją galite parsisiųsti jau šiandien!


Taip pat buvo pranešta apie .NET Framework logotipo pasikeitimus, kuris nuo šiol atrodys taip:


Rodyk draugams

Galingas duomenų vizualizavimo komponentas skirtas ASP.NET ir Windows formoms

Parašė Sergejus | 2008-10-27 00:37

Kas programuoja .NET ir ypač web aplikacijas gerai žino, kad šiam momentui iš Microsoft nebuvo gero spendimo grafikams piešti. Mūsų laimei situacija keičiasi, nes pasirodė MS Chart duomenų vizualizavimo komponentas skirtas ASP.NET ir Windows Forms. Siūloma net virš 200(!) skirtingo tipo grafikų ir viskas tai nemokamai!



 


Taigi pats komponentas prieinamas čia. Papildomai siūlau suinstaliuoti Visual Studio priedą, įgalinanti intellisense panaudojimą su šiuo komponentu ir jo API dokumentaciją.


PASTABA


Duomenų vizualizavimo komponentas veikia tik su Visual Studio 2008 ir .NET Framework 3.5 SP1.

Rodyk draugams

Tiesioginės transliacijos iš PDC

Parašė Sergejus | 2008-10-26 10:49

Pirmadienį JAV prasideda PDC (Professional Developer Conferencija) konferencija. Skirtingai negu visos kitos konferencijos, ji vyksta ne kas N metų, o kada Microsoft turi parodyti kažką naujo ir įdomaus. Patikėkite, tikrai bus į ką pasižiūrėti, tad raginu žiūrėti tiesiogines transliacijas.


Visos transliacijos vyks nuo 8:30 AM iki 10:30 AM vakarinės pakratnės laiku (pagal mūsų 17:30 - 19:30).


Pirmadienį, spalio 27 - 100 kbps | 300 kbps | 750 kbps


Antradienį, spalio 28 - 100 kbps | 300 kbps | 750 kbps

Rodyk draugams

Testuojamas LINQ to SQL duomenų atvaizdavimas ASP.NET lentelėse - 2 dalis

Parašė Sergejus | 2008-10-25 22:07

Praeitoje testuojamų LINQ to SQL duomenų atvaizdavimo ASP.NET lentelėse dalyje aš parodžiau, kaip atskiriant duomenų gavimą nuo ASP.NET galima pagerinti bendrą testuojamumą. Šiandien aš pratęsiu minėtą pavyzdį papildant jį filtravimo funkcionalumu.




Tarkime, mes norime Products lentelės duomenis filtruoti pagal kategoriją. Tam papildykime prieš tai apibrėžtą ProductService klasę:




Kaip matyti, mes aprašėme naujus GetPage ir Count metodus, kurie naudoja bazinius metodus bei turi papildomą categoryId argumentą, pagal kurį ir bus filtruojami duomenys.




Atitinkamai turime atnaujinti ir mūsų ASP.NET puslapį:



Pirma į ką reikia atkreipti dėmesį – mūsų objektinis duomenų šalinis odsProducts nuo šiol priima argumentą categoryId, kurio reikšmė ateina iš elemento ddlCategories. Mūsų išskleidžiamas sąrašas užsipildo duomenimis naudojant naujai apibrėžtą objektinį duomenų šaltinį odsCategories, o tas savo ruožtu naudoja CategoryService klasės metodą GetList. Šios klasės kodas pateiktas žemiau:



Kadangi norint užpildyti išskleidžiamą sąrašą duomenimis nebūtina krauti visų objektų pilnai, o užtenka tik kelių savybių, aš apibrėžiau bendrinį objektą ServiceList, kurį ir susieju su išskleidžiamu sąrašu. Pati klasė atrodo laibai paprastai:




Taigi taip nesunkiai mes galime pridėti duomenų bazės filtravimo galimybę ASP.NET lentelėse išlaikant puikų duomenų testuojamumą!

P.S.

Jeigu turite minčių, kaip dar labiau galima pagerinti ASP.NET testuojamumą - rašykite komentaruose!

Rodyk draugams

Aš lieku Lietuvoje

Parašė Sergejus | 2008-10-20 20:29

Tuo viskas ir pasakyta. Prieš kelias minutes nusiunčiau savo galutinį sprendimą į Redmondą. Aš atsisakiau to, dėl ko daugelis tik svajoja. Logika šiame pasirinkime yra, bet tikriausiai suprantama tik man…

Rodyk draugams